The National Park Service (NPS) has announced its intention to award a grant of $52,500 to the National Trust for Historic Preservation (NTHP) for the Diversity Scholarship Program and evaluation of the Multiple Voices track during the Past Forward Conference scheduled for November 3-6, 2015, in Washington, DC. This funding will be provided without a competitive application process under a Cooperative Agreement aimed at promoting historic preservation.
The primary goals of this collaboration include increasing public participation in historic preservation, supporting underrepresented communities, and enhancing awareness of cultural heritage. The grant encompasses the management and distribution of funds for 40 diversity scholarships to attend the conference, as well as the provision of a detailed evaluation of the Multiple Voices Learning Track, focusing on “Correcting and Completing the Narrative.”
The NPS will play a significant role by sponsoring, participating in sessions, and providing materials to raise awareness about their initiatives. This partnership allows for prominent marketing opportunities, including acknowledgment as a principal sponsor, media coverage, and access to conference attendees.
The justification for this non-competitive award is based on the continuation of previously funded activities that are essential for achieving ongoing objectives related to historic preservation and community engagement.Apply for P15AS00345
